State University of Kentucky Framing Option:Black and Gold Frame the manuscript maps were interceptedRichard Rummell State University of Kentucky Re strike engraving from the original plate (c. 1913). Printed on heavy woven paper and hand colored. Plate size: 17 1 4 x 29 At the turn of the century, Littig & Company commissioned the accomplished artist Richard Rummell (1848 1924) to create watercolors of some of the nations most prestigious colleges.
